Output 1df6defccc5bfc5d174539836ffd101c41746c35c5981556724d2d0b5c00512a:3

value
112790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21f36f93dfa910ee0597dfde995db99be707d91c OP_EQUAL
address
34nXr6NxTqZnsz3nc2sPqLawica9mK9K7c
transaction
1df6defccc5bfc5d174539836ffd101c41746c35c5981556724d2d0b5c00512a
spent
true